Home > Technical Support > Downloadable licences > Some searches are slow even though elasticsearch is configured

Some searches are slow even though elasticsearch is configured

By default elasticsearch is used only for fulltext search (when searcing for some specific text) and for some computationally intensive filters (exclude tag, message added by user, message added on date and time).

If you want to enable use of elasticsearch for all searches, you can do it by adding setting name='force_es' and value='Y' to table qu_g_settings.

The risk of using elasticsearch for all searches is that if the data in elasticsearch index is not up to date with the source data in MySQL database, the results may not be 100% same as search in database would return. This may be caused by delay up to a minute in updating the elasticsearch index, which is done by a background task executed by queue.php cron job.

Ready to try LiveAgent?

It's free for the first 14 days! No credit card required.

Get Started
We work well with others...
Magento Joomla Wordpress Mailchimp
Contact us


+1-800-811-6590 (Toll Free in USA & Canada)

+421 2 33 456 826 (European Union & Worldwide)

Quality Unit, LLC 616 Corporate Way, Suite 2-3278 Valley Cottage, NY 10989

Stay in touch
Blog Google+
© 2004-2015 QualityUnit.com, All rights reserved